What can I use as a backdrop for photos?
There are several options you can use as a backdrop for photos. Some popular choices include solid-colored walls, fabric backdrops, paper backdrops, nature settings, and cityscapes. Solid-colored walls provide a clean and simple background that can make your subject stand out. Fabric backdrops offer a variety of textures and patterns to add visual interest to your photos. Paper backdrops are versatile and come in various colors and designs. Nature settings, such as parks or gardens, can provide a beautiful and organic backdrop. Cityscapes offer a dynamic and urban backdrop with architectural elements. Ultimately, the choice of backdrop depends on the desired aesthetic and theme of your photos.

2、 Urban cityscapes and architecture
When it comes to choosing a backdrop for photos, urban cityscapes and architecture offer a dynamic and visually appealing option. The towering skyscrapers, intricate bridges, and bustling streets create a captivating backdrop that can add depth and interest to your photographs.
Urban cityscapes provide a diverse range of architectural styles, from modern glass structures to historic buildings with intricate details. This variety allows you to experiment with different compositions and capture unique perspectives. The juxtaposition of old and new architecture can create a visually striking contrast, adding a layer of complexity to your photos.
In addition to the architectural elements, urban cityscapes offer a vibrant atmosphere. The hustle and bustle of the city can add a sense of energy and liveliness to your images. The constant movement of people, vehicles, and lights can create dynamic and captivating scenes.
To make the most of urban cityscapes as a backdrop, consider shooting during the golden hour. The warm, soft light during sunrise or sunset can beautifully illuminate the buildings and create a magical atmosphere. Experiment with different angles and viewpoints to capture the essence of the city and highlight its unique features.
Furthermore, incorporating leading lines from the architecture or using reflections from glass buildings can add depth and visual interest to your photos. Don't be afraid to explore different perspectives, such as shooting from high vantage points or getting up close to capture intricate details.
Overall, urban cityscapes and architecture offer a versatile and captivating backdrop for photos. With their ever-changing nature and endless possibilities, they provide a perfect canvas for your creativity to shine.
